Alpine's Electric A110 Future: A Lightweight Revolution

Alpine has unveiled the A110 Future, a development mule that offers a tantalizing glimpse into the future of electric sports cars. This concept vehicle is a testament to Alpine's commitment to pushing the boundaries of automotive engineering, blending the lightweight, agile character of the A110 with the power and efficiency of electric technology.

The Lightweight Electric Revolution

What makes the A110 Future particularly intriguing is its emphasis on maintaining the lightweight, low-slung, and playful nature of its predecessor while embracing electrification. This is a significant challenge in the automotive world, as electric powertrains often result in heavier vehicles. Alpine's solution is the Alpine Performance Platform, a modular aluminium architecture designed specifically for electric sports cars.

The platform's key innovation is its use of split battery packs, positioned to preserve a 40:60 front-to-rear balance. This approach ensures that the driving experience remains low and agile, rather than raising the vehicle's center of gravity and compromising its dynamic handling.

Technical Muscle Under the Hood

Under the hood (or, rather, within the car's structure), the A110 Future showcases cutting-edge technology. It employs 800V cell-to-pack battery technology, which promises rapid charging and high energy density. Additionally, a new rear dual-motor 3-in-1 e-axle with a silicon-carbide inverter is designed to deliver strong torque and dynamic response, characteristics that have defined the A110's reputation.

While specific power, range, weight, and charging figures remain undisclosed, the focus is on the engineering intent. Alpine aims to create a sports car that combines the thrill of acceleration with the efficiency and environmental benefits of electric power.

A Global Perspective

The A110 Future's debut at the Goodwood Festival of Speed is a strategic move. It showcases Alpine's commitment to pushing the boundaries of electric performance and highlights the potential for electric cars to embody the spirit of sports cars. However, the absence of a confirmed New Zealand plan for the next A110 raises questions about the global reach of this technology.
